Lynching At Whitebird (Special to the Obterver) Qrangeville; Idaho, June 8 GriiDgeville toilny has boen doiuf! uotoing but talltidji about the lynch ing of Thomas Myera lor the murder o( Oeorge Browolee near Whitebird Huturday, On aocouot of the town not being cn;oected with telephone service, ill finite infomiaiioc van uot reoeived from Whitebird until late yesterday alternoou and during the early part of the day all kinds of rumors were afloat. The body of Meyers was found bang ing to a tree at the mouth of White- bird canyon about one and a half miles above Whitebird. The rope bad been plaocd around his neck with a common slip noose ind the other end thrown over a limb and made fast. Whether Meyers was raised from chegaoundo' was jerked from bis norse is not known :y the general .iiblic but on account of the distance of his feet from tbe pround and the 'net that his horfe was left tied to mo tiee, it is pmtable that be was jerkrd from the animal as rumored yesumldy. Meiers is known to bave spo'ten, ti'jt nnce aftpj the mob caught him. When all hope of esenpe had passed, he with memb r nl (he mor on all Hides of Inni dismounted from his horse and cooly remarked. "Weill gue's you have got me," A member ol ibe mob teplied: "You bet we have." Tlia closing rcne of the tragedy wi'.l remain a secret with the members of the mob who avenged tbe murder of George Brownlee. Special Excursion to the Worla's Fair. Stanley 3055 La Grande National B nk Colorado Democrats Puehln, Colo, June 8 The demo crats today named delegates the national ennvf-utirn at Hi Loum. The delegation goes uninsiriicled . Tb Ht'sist psnplo captured the caucus heh' by tbe second district delegates, hut wlien lh"'y attempted to pass a re-ol I'ion instructing for Hearst through the c invention it was turned line"-.
